Often referred to as the invisible spectrum due to the lack ...An older asexual symbol is the AVEN triangle, which used a black-to-white gradient to represent the asexual spectrum, with white representing allosexuality and black representing asexuality. This gradient is what inspired the white, grey, and black stripes of the asexual flag. EtymologyAsexuality is a sexual orientation that involves a lack of sexual attraction. This gradient is what inspired the white, grey, and black stripes of the asexual flag. EtymologyOct 26, 2020 · In our sample of over 40,000 LGBTQ youth, 10% identified as asexual or ace spectrum. When given additional options to describe their sexual orientation, asexual youth further selected demisexual (15%), polyamorous (9%), and greysexual (9%). Gray asexuality, grey asexuality, or gray-sexuality is the spectrum between asexuality and allosexuality. Individuals who identify with gray asexuality are referred to as being gray-A, gray ace, and make up what is referred to as the "ace umbrella". Asexuality 101 Asexuality, briefly defined, means having (little to) no sexual attraction. Asexuality exists on a spectrum, because sexual attraction is notoriously hard to define, and people who feel they might experience sexual attraction in some limited way are still allowed to identify as asexual. Gray asexuality is considered the gray area between asexuality and allosexuality, in which a person may only experience sexual attraction on occasion. [1] [2] The term gray-A covers a range of identities under the asexuality umbrella, or on the asexual spectrum, including demisexuality. [9] Other terms within this spectrum include semisexual ... Here, three people who identify as "ace" (or asexual) explain what the orientation means to them. Jul 18, 2021 · Asexual as an Orientation vs Asexual as a Spectrum. The term "Asexual" can refer to both an orientation and to the asexual spectrum (consisting of the asexual orientation and the grey identities). The context of a sentence usually tells which of the two the word Asexual is referring to, although sometimes it can be unclear. The Asexuality Spectrum. 4 min read.
